Parts list
Main components, grouped by system.
Bike components
Frame
Frame
AL-6061 Alloy Gravel, Thru-Axle, Disc Tabs, Taper Headtube
Suspension Fork
Alloy SPF Formed, Tapered Steerer, Thru-Axle, Disc Post Mount
Drivetrain
Rear Derailleur
Shimano Claris RD-2000, 8 Speed
Front Derailleur
Shimano Claris FD-2000
Shift Levers
Shimano Claris ST-2000, 8 Speed
Cassette
Shimano Claris HG-50 8 Speed, 11-32
Crank
Alloy 3peice Road Crank, 46/34 Tooth, Square Taper
Bottom Bracket
Sealed Cartirdge Bearing
Chain
KMC X8
Pedals
Resin Platform Pedal
Wheels
Front Hub
Alloy Disc, Thru-Axle 15mm, 28 Hole
Rear Hub
Alloy Disc, Thru-Axle, 28 Hole
Rims
Raleigh Alloy Double Wall, 700c, 28 Hole
Spokes
14g Stainless with Brass Nipples
Tires
Clement X'PLOR USH, 700x35c
Brakes
Brakes
Tektro Lyra Mechanical Disc, 160mm Rotors
Brake Levers
Shimano Claris
Cockpit
Stem
Raleigh 7° 3D Forged, 31.8, 90/100/110mm
Handlebar
Raleigh 200 series 31.8 with 12 Degree Flare, 38/40/42/44
Headset
Integrated Cartridge Bearings
Seat
Saddle
Raleigh Woman's Series Saddle with Steel Rail
Seatpost
Raleigh Alloy Micro Adjust 27.2
Fit data
Numbers for sizing and ride feel.
| Size | 48cm | 50cm | 52cm | 54cm | 56cm |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Stack Reach Ratio | 1.39 mm | 1.44 mm | 1.51 mm | 1.52 mm | 1.54 mm |
| Bottom Bracket Height | 276 mm | 276 mm | 276 mm | 279 mm | 279 mm |
| Front Center | 576 mm | 584 mm | 588 mm | 593 mm | 601 mm |
| Rake | 50 mm | 50 mm | 50 mm | 50 mm | 50 mm |
| Trail | 73 mm | 68 mm | 63 mm | 61 mm | 60 mm |
| Stack | 502 mm | 527 mm | 548 mm | 562 mm | 583 mm |
| Reach | 362 mm | 365 mm | 364 mm | 370 mm | 378 mm |
| Top Tube Length | 501 mm | 516 mm | 526 mm | 541 mm | 556 mm |
| Seat Tube Angle | 74.5 ° | 74 ° | 73.5 ° | 73 ° | 73 ° |
| Seat Tube Length | 435 mm | 460 mm | 485 mm | 510 mm | 535 mm |
| Head Tube Angle | 70 ° | 70.5 ° | 71 ° | 71.5 ° | 72 ° |
| Head Tube Length | 105 mm | 130 mm | 150 mm | 165 mm | 185 mm |
| Chainstay Length | 411 mm | 411 mm | 411 mm | 411 mm | 411 mm |
| Wheelbase | 976 mm | 984 mm | 988 mm | 994 mm | 1002 mm |
| Bottom Bracket Drop | 72 mm | 72 mm | 72 mm | 70 mm | 70 mm |
| Standover Height | 706 mm | 731 mm | 756 mm | 776 mm | 801 mm |
| Wheels | 700 | 700 | 700 | 700 | 700 |

Overview of components
Fork material
The fork on this bike is made out of aluminum, which doesn’t add too much extra weight to the bike. However, it is not so stiff as steel or carbon forks are.
Wheels size
The Amelia 1 2019 bike is equipped with 700c aluminum wheels when leaving the factory. There is no doubt, that 700c wheels are very popular on all road bike models. However, while they give you great speed and control, these wheels are not so bump-friendly.
Brakes
Nothing is more important on a bike than its ability to brake properly. Raleigh Amelia 1 is equipped with Mechanical Disc brakes. These brakes are also very popular, and a lot cheaper than hydraulic disk brakes. However, they don’t have the stopping power of hydraulic brakes.
